Not to beat a severely wounded horse, but one reason for implementing a detailed file function (and probably why it hasn't been tackled) is that getting the detailed file information from a command shell is decidedly  NOT straightforward. *NIX has an ls function, and also has a date function. The date function cannot it seems accept spaces in the name, but will accept relative paths like ~/Desktop/test.xlsx. ls -r will only give you the year if the date is beyond 6 months from present. Date accepts a path in quotes or not, but if there is a space in the path you must enclose in quotes. ls decidedly CANNOT have a quoted path. 

Windows gets dicier. Typically you would use WMIC and build a query, but I think it only works with local files, and not network shares (Parallels uses network paths for Mac FolderSharing). It uses back slashes, and these have to be escaped as in \\. 

There are a number of other gotchas for each platform, but the upshot is that it's a beatch trying to piece together shell commands that work reliably in all use cases for every platform. I am sure that after a half a day and struggling through all the exceptions for each platform I could piece together a way to do it, but it's a real pig I can tell you. 

